How can I ensure that the React freelancer has the right technical skills for my project?
Review the freelancer's past work and portfolio to see examples of similar projects they've completed. Look for evidence of proficiency in React, as well as complementary skills such as state management libraries (e.g., Redux), component libraries, and experience with related tools like Webpack or Babel. Consider conducting a technical interview or a small coding challenge to further assess their capabilities.
What steps should I take to define clear deliverables for a React project with a freelancer?
Start by discussing the project scope in detail, including all desired features and the specific functionality of the user interface. Clearly outline the milestones and deliverables, such as prototypes, wireframes, or completed components. Establish a timeline and agree on metrics for success, like responsiveness or load times, to ensure that both parties have a shared understanding of the project goals.
What should I include in the initial kickoff meeting with a React freelancer on Contra?
During the kickoff meeting, clearly communicate the project's objectives, timeline, and expected outcomes. Discuss any existing codebases or design system guidelines the freelancer should be aware of. Establish the preferred communication channels and frequency of check-ins. It's also important to cover any relevant documentation or resources the freelancer may need access to, so they can get started efficiently.
Who is Contra for?
Contra is designed for both freelancers (referred to as "independents") and clients. Freelancers can showcase their work, connect with clients, and manage projects commission-free. Clients can discover and hire top freelance talent for their projects.
What is the vision of Contra?
Contra aims to revolutionize the world of work by providing an all-in-one platform that empowers freelancers and clients to connect and collaborate seamlessly, eliminating traditional barriers and commission fees.